            My 1986 FXRT. Bought in 2017, unfortunately at some point prior to getting to me it had the fairings and bags removed. Since owning it I’ve gone through it fairly extensively:

            S&S V111 Crate Motor
            Super E carb
            90+ Primary and Starter Conversion
            Barnett Clutch
            FXDX Forks
            HD Brembo Calipers
            Chopper Haus Floating Rotors
            DogFight Moto Risers
            Speed Kings Mid Bend Bars
            96+ controls
            Black Levers
            ODI Grips
            Saddlemen x SDC Seat and back rest
            Legends Revo 13” rear shocks
            Dunlop American Elite tires
            Thunderheader
            Leather Pros Bags
            Black Powder Coated 9 Spoke Wheels
            Integrated Tail Light Assembly
            Moons Front Signals
            Moto Gadget M.Unit Blue
            Custom Wiring harness
            LED Headlamp
            HD Quick Release Windshield

            Next up is a Baker 6 speed, swing arm bearing upgrade, and paint.

                              This 2014 BMW R1200R is my primary travel bike. After 10 years and 71000 km I decided to give it some TLC in recognition of the wonderful travel memories she has provided me. Dropped her off 7 weeks ago at a friend’s shop, MOTOTECH.
                              Things took a bit long because I had a trip to the US in between where I had to bring back some bits and pieces for her.
                              A long and varied list of work was carried out:
                              Tank was professionally polished;
                              valve covers were repainted;
                              Telelever was repainted;
                              rear rack painted black (originally silver);
                              BMW tank badges were painted (originals are stick-on and they fall off when the glue dries/cracks) as I lost both during one trip last year. The painter did a masterful job…I’ll take detailed pics later on;
                              Bought new mirrors from Motogadget (no glass!!..all aluminum, ultra polished)
                              Rebuild of front forks and steering damper (although it is a Telelever bike, the forks do some damping, transmit steering, and firm up the front end)
                              New driver footrest rubber pads
                              Cleaned up the tank cover and locking mechanism (it had progressively gotten hard to turn the key due to gunk buildup)
                              Added a Rapid Bike module from DIMSPORT to smooth out power delivery and improve torque (marginally) at low RPMs.
                              I think that was about it. The total bill added up to about 650 $us. That does not include the bits purchased in the US ( which added an extra 200 dollars + or -).
                              If the weather helps, and road blockades don’t impede our plans we’ll set out on Saturday on a 7-8 day trip to Iquique(Chilean port). That should be a good test for my refreshed steed!
